Notables on the cycle include Maldyn the Unkempt and Brother Zephyl. This is also the spawn point for Hasten Bootstrutter's cycle. Most notably, the hill giants are moved to the plataeu in the Northeast section (hang a right from the Feerrott entrance). With the Guktan invasion of Rath Mountains, several key mobs have been moved from their traditional places/pathing. So what does that all mean? It is possible for Hasten to become stuck beneath a rock near the Hill Giant area of the mountains. Hasten can initially be found in the hill giant area of the Rathe Mountains, although he tends to wander quickly throughout the area. The boots cast a spell which gives you a movement boost. In return for 3,250 gold (or 325 platinum), the ring of the ancients from the Ancient Cyclops and a shadowed rapier from the Shadowmen, he will give you the Journeyman's Boots. In the Mountains of Rathe: Hasten is the bearer of a lovely set of boots which he stole from Drelzna in Najena.
